This page lists Bob Dylan stereo promotional singles in all formats from 2000 onwards. They do not contain rarities, but are none the less very collectable. All the singles included here were released exclusively for promotional purposes - promotional releases of commercially released singles that don't contain rarities are listed on the various US & International Stereo Singles & EPs pages, see International Stereo Releases. For illustrations of all the generic 7" single sleeves used by Bob's record companies from the 1960s onwards, see the 7" Single Sleeves page. (A single has much less value to a collector if it doesn't have its correct original sleeve.) For earlier promotional singles, see the links above.

Music From The Motion Picture "Wonder Boys" - promo CD singles, Columbia/Sony Music Soundtrax CSK 46489 (USA), Jan 2000/Columbia PRCD 98028 (Mexico), 2000:
For the DVD release of Wonder Boys, see VHS & DVD 2000s Part 1. The film contains both the full version of the song played over the closing credits, and a shorter version played over the opening credits.


Columbia/Sony Music Soundtrax CSK 46489 (USA) - Columbia PRCD 98028 (Mexico) has the same front (my copy)

This promo one-track CD single comes in a regular jewel case with front and rear inserts.

R-0299 Things Have Changed - a song written and recorded specially for this film in 1999, lyrics on bobdylan.com
Now no longer a rarity since it is included in The Essential Bob Dylan (2000) on the bobdylan.com albums page.

The insert notes say this is Bob's first song written and performed especially for a movie since Pat Garrett & Billy The Kid in 1973. The writer has obviously not referred to these pages, where he or she would have found Band Of The Hand from the film of the same name in 1986, and Night After Night plus Had A Dream About You, Baby from Hearts Of Fire in 1987!

There is also a Mexican version of this promo CD single, Columbia PRCD 98028. This is the only Mexican Dylan promo CD single so far. When the film was released in Mexico it was retitled Loco Fin De Semana [Crazy Weekend] but here it is still Wonder Boys.

The CD-R test pressings shown here are of the full song. The first comes in a plain black card sleeve and is undated, the second is dated "1/11/00" (11 Jan 2000), and the third is dated 5 Feb 2001 and comes in a slimline CD single jewel case with an insert.

"Four Songs From "Love And Theft"" - promo CD singles, Columbia COL 1731 (USA)/Columbia CSK 32657 (USA)/Columbia XPCD 1388 (UK)/Columbia (no catalogue number) (Australia), Aug 2001:

LTpromocover.JPG (35771 bytes)
Columbia CSK 32657 (USA) - rear of sleeve, scan by Peter Stone Brown (the front is plain black with a circular cut-out to allow the CD to  be seen)
This CD features the tracks Summer Days, Bye And Bye, Honest With Me and Floater (Too Much To Ask). The CD design mimics the Columbia "6-eye" LP label design of the 1960s, see 1962 onwards.

This sampler was available in a jewel case as well as the cardboard sleeve shown, and also a plain silver glass-mastered version of the CD with just text and the Columbia logo. The UK release, catalogue number XPCD 1388, was in a different red sleeve. The CD label is a different "antique" Columbia design. "Tweedle Dee And Tweedle Dum"/"Bye And Bye" - promo vinyl 7" single, Columbia CS7 32660/ZSS 32660 A/B (USA), Sep 2001:


Columbia CS7 32660/ZSS 32660 A/B (USA) - A-side of 7" single, photo by Scott Bauer

This was given away by independent record stores in the USA with purchases of the regular version of "Love And Theft", not the Limited Edition listed in 2001! The sleeve is unique, black with white and red text/graphics.

The sleeve front has the words "COLUMBIA" and "7" SINGLE" in the red stripes. and the code "ORAW 2850" on the rear. The record itself has the words "Promotional - Not for Sale" and "Special Limited Edition" on the label. Thanks to John Pruski and Scott Bauer for information, and to Hans Seegers for scans.

"The Bootleg Series Vol. 5 - Bob Dylan Live 1975: The Rolling Thunder Revue"  - promo CD single, Columbia SM 5013135 A - TRUTONE CSK 87047 (USA), Nov 2002:


CSK 87047 (USA) - front of insert, scan by Hans Seegers

This 4-track promo CD sampler for the album was released to radio and the press. Tracks are A Hard Rain's A-Gonna Fall; A Simple Twist Of Fate; Hurricane; I Shall Be Released. The CD comes in a transparent plastic wallet with a very thin folded paper insert wrapped round it.

"Dylan Live E.P." - four-track promo CD single, Columbia/Legacy 886971 74682 (Europe), Sep 2007; Columbia Legacy 886971 38862 (Europe), Sep 2007:

Dylan07FinFront.JPG (19422 bytes)
Columbia/Legacy 886971 74682 (Europe) - front of card sleeve, photo by Hervé from France
This live 4-track CD single in a card sleeve promoting the 2007 Dylan 3CD set is being given away at branches of the Finnish menswear store Dress Mann with purchases of a shirt! Tracks (not from the set and all regular album tracks) are:
  1. Don't Think Twice, It's All Right from The Bootleg Series Vol. 6 - Live 1964
  2. It Ain't Me, Babe from The Bootleg Series Vol. 5 - Live 1975
  3. Shelter From The Storm from Hard Rain
  4. Tangled Up In Blue from Real Live.
